Key Responsibilities
Provide leadership to internal sales desk professionals (RSD and/or NSC) including coaching and development. Manage performance metrics and expectations, utilizing leading indicators and scorecards. Establishes and maintains an environment and sales culture that attracts, motivates, retains and inspires team Conduct continual performance and skill assessment of internal sales desk professionals.
Effectively partner with sales management and sales support areas, including marketing, product development, new business, underwriting and service delivery on commitments to clients and advisors. Assist in the development and implementation of sales training programs.
Partner with Divisional Vice President (DVP) to ensure wholesaling team is partnering in an effective manner to manage the territory. Provide training and sales coaching to wholesaling teams to strengthen sales acumen.
Work with senior management to develop the department's strategic plans, objectives and goals. Prepare sales reports and other metrics for management that provide insights to leading and lagging indicators and influence coaching and territory management plans.
Recommend appropriate staffing levels, provide input to the budget process, and make decisions regarding hiring, compensation, performance appraisals, training and development, and other related personnel actions. In addition, assist in the development and implementation of sales training.
Drive a culture of compliance, including ongoing call monitoring, coaching and feedback. Monitor and enhance the quality and effectiveness of telephone sales efforts of their sales desk personnel.
Required Qualifications
Bachelor's degree or equivalent
Series 7 (or ability to obtain within 90-days of hire, if multiple exams are required, an additional 90-day window will be added after successfully passing each exam).
Series 24 (or ability to obtain within 90-days of hire, if multiple exams are required, an additional 90-day window will be added after successfully passing each exam).
Series 63/66 (or ability to obtain within 90-days of hire, if multiple exams are required, an additional 90-day window will be added after successfully passing each exam).
Resident State Insurance Licenses (Variable Life & Health)
7 to 10 years relevant Experience
5+ years of industry related experience with at least 2 years on an annuity/insurance sales desk required.
Ability to lead, coach, mentor and develop sales professionals.
Strong knowledge of insurance company products and services.
Preferred Qualifications
Previous leadership and/or mentorship experience
